Output b918582ab24868f3b1e68d26b98e3341b585f4c01b294af032fa47faa52f1ca7:0

value
16657946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d6479aa9763514bf3e6eb0f61fff6c3ed8f7f995ad71634ea41c5f6ca595e94
address
bc1ph4j8n25hvdg5hulxav8krllkc0kc7luettt3vd82g8zldjjet62q6j5nta
transaction
b918582ab24868f3b1e68d26b98e3341b585f4c01b294af032fa47faa52f1ca7
confirmations
3939
spent
true